Home
last modified time | relevance | path

Searched refs:signatureFileDir (Results 1 - 16 of 16) sorted by relevance

/foundation/bundlemanager/bundle_framework/services/bundlemgr/src/ipc/
H A Dcode_signature_param.cpp29 constexpr const char* CODE_SIGNATURE_SIGNATURE_FILE_PATH = "signatureFileDir";
41 signatureFileDir = Str16ToStr8(parcel.ReadString16()); in ReadFromParcel()
54 WRITE_PARCEL_AND_RETURN_FALSE_IF_FAIL(String16, parcel, Str8ToStr16(signatureFileDir)); in Marshalling()
79 { CODE_SIGNATURE_SIGNATURE_FILE_PATH, signatureFileDir }, in ToString()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/include/ipc/
H A Dcode_signature_param.h31 std::string signatureFileDir; member
/foundation/bundlemanager/bundle_framework/services/bundlemgr/include/shared/
H A Dinner_shared_bundle_installer.h119 const std::string &targetSoPath, const std::string &signatureFileDir, bool isPreInstalledBundle) const;
/foundation/bundlemanager/bundle_framework/services/bundlemgr/src/shared/
H A Dinner_shared_bundle_installer.cpp719 const std::string &cpuAbi, const std::string &targetSoPath, const std::string &signatureFileDir, in VerifyCodeSignatureForNativeFiles()
732 codeSignatureParam.signatureFileDir = signatureFileDir; in VerifyCodeSignatureForNativeFiles()
750 codeSignatureParam.signatureFileDir = signatureFileDir_; in VerifyCodeSignatureForHsp()
718 VerifyCodeSignatureForNativeFiles(const std::string &bundlePath, const std::string &cpuAbi, const std::string &targetSoPath, const std::string &signatureFileDir, bool isPreInstalledBundle) const VerifyCodeSignatureForNativeFiles() argument
/foundation/bundlemanager/bundle_framework/services/bundlemgr/test/unittest/bms_install_daemon_test/
H A Dbms_install_daemon_operator_test.cpp974 codeSignatureParam.signatureFileDir = ""; in HWTEST_F()
1109 codeSignatureParam.signatureFileDir = "/"; in HWTEST_F()
1540 codeSignatureParam.signatureFileDir = ""; in HWTEST_F()
1808 codeSignatureParam.signatureFileDir = "test"; in HWTEST_F()
1825 codeSignatureParam.signatureFileDir = ""; in HWTEST_F()
1844 codeSignatureParam.signatureFileDir = ""; in HWTEST_F()
1864 codeSignatureParam.signatureFileDir = ""; in HWTEST_F()
H A Dbms_install_daemon_ipc_test.cpp553 codeSignatureParam.signatureFileDir = TEST_STRING; in HWTEST_F()
575 codeSignatureParam.signatureFileDir = TEST_STRING; in HWTEST_F()
925 codeSignatureParam.signatureFileDir = TEST_STRING; in HWTEST_F()
H A Dbms_install_daemon_host_impl_test.cpp785 codeSignatureParam.signatureFileDir = TEST_STRING; in HWTEST_F()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/src/
H A Dbase_bundle_installer.cpp4798 std::string signatureFileDir = ""; in SaveHapPathToRecords() local
4799 FindSignatureFileDir(item.second.GetCurModuleName(), signatureFileDir); in SaveHapPathToRecords()
4802 signatureFileMap_.emplace(item.first, signatureFileDir); in SaveHapPathToRecords()
5221 std::string signatureFileDir = ""; in InnerProcessNativeLibs() local
5222 auto ret = FindSignatureFileDir(info.GetCurModuleName(), signatureFileDir); in InnerProcessNativeLibs()
5230 result = VerifyCodeSignatureForNativeFiles(info, cpuAbi, targetSoPath, signatureFileDir); in InnerProcessNativeLibs()
5247 const std::string &targetSoPath, const std::string &signatureFileDir) const in VerifyCodeSignatureForNativeFiles()
5259 codeSignatureParam.signatureFileDir = signatureFileDir; in VerifyCodeSignatureForNativeFiles()
5281 std::string signatureFileDir in VerifyCodeSignatureForHap() local
5431 FindSignatureFileDir(const std::string &moduleName, std::string &signatureFileDir) FindSignatureFileDir() argument
[all...]
H A Dbundle_install_checker.cpp1532 ErrCode BundleInstallChecker::CheckSignatureFileDir(const std::string &signatureFileDir) const in CheckSignatureFileDir()
1534 if (!BundleUtil::CheckFileName(signatureFileDir)) { in CheckSignatureFileDir()
1538 if (!BundleUtil::CheckFileType(signatureFileDir, ServiceConstants::CODE_SIGNATURE_FILE_SUFFIX)) { in CheckSignatureFileDir()
1539 LOG_E(BMS_TAG_INSTALLER, "signatureFileDir is not suffixed with .sig"); in CheckSignatureFileDir()
1542 // signatureFileDir not support relevant dir in CheckSignatureFileDir()
1543 if (signatureFileDir.find(ServiceConstants::RELATIVE_PATH) != std::string::npos) { in CheckSignatureFileDir()
1544 LOG_E(BMS_TAG_INSTALLER, "signatureFileDir is invalid"); in CheckSignatureFileDir()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/include/
H A Dbundle_install_checker.h166 ErrCode CheckSignatureFileDir(const std::string &signatureFileDir) const;
H A Dbase_bundle_installer.h637 ErrCode FindSignatureFileDir(const std::string &moduleName, std::string &signatureFileDir);
680 const std::string &targetSoPath, const std::string &signatureFileDir) const;
/foundation/bundlemanager/bundle_framework/services/bundlemgr/test/unittest/bms_bundle_overlay_test/
H A Dbms_bundle_overlay_checker_test.cpp2995 std::string signatureFileDir; in HWTEST_F() local
2998 ErrCode res = installer.FindSignatureFileDir(TEST_MODULE_NAME + "1", signatureFileDir); in HWTEST_F()
3010 std::string signatureFileDir; in HWTEST_F() local
3013 ErrCode res = installer.FindSignatureFileDir(TEST_MODULE_NAME, signatureFileDir); in HWTEST_F()
3025 std::string signatureFileDir = "testModuleName.sig"; in HWTEST_F() local
3027 installer.verifyCodeParams_.emplace(TEST_MODULE_NAME, signatureFileDir); in HWTEST_F()
3028 ErrCode res = installer.FindSignatureFileDir(TEST_MODULE_NAME, signatureFileDir); in HWTEST_F()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/src/app_service_fwk/
H A Dapp_service_fwk_installer.cpp615 codeSignatureParam.signatureFileDir = ""; in VerifyCodeSignatureForHsp()
1093 codeSignatureParam.signatureFileDir = ""; in VerifyCodeSignatureForNativeFiles()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/test/unittest/bms_bundle_app_provision_info_test/
H A Dbms_bundle_app_provision_info_test.cpp1902 std::string signatureFileDir; in HWTEST_F() local
1905 cpuAbi, targetSoPath, signatureFileDir, isPreInstalledBundle); in HWTEST_F()
1909 cpuAbi, targetSoPath, signatureFileDir, isPreInstalledBundle); in HWTEST_F()
/foundation/bundlemanager/bundle_framework/services/bundlemgr/src/installd/
H A Dinstalld_host_impl.cpp1416 if (codeSignatureParam.signatureFileDir.empty()) { in VerifyCodeSignatureForHap()
1434 LOG_D(BMS_TAG_INSTALLD, "Verify code signature with: %{public}s", codeSignatureParam.signatureFileDir.c_str()); in VerifyCodeSignatureForHap()
1435 ret = Security::CodeSign::CodeSignUtils::EnforceCodeSignForApp(entryMap, codeSignatureParam.signatureFileDir); in VerifyCodeSignatureForHap()
H A Dinstalld_operator.cpp1372 if (codeSignatureParam.signatureFileDir.empty()) { in PerformCodeSignatureCheck()
1387 ret = CodeSignUtils::EnforceCodeSignForApp(entryMap, codeSignatureParam.signatureFileDir); in PerformCodeSignatureCheck()

Completed in 39 milliseconds